[ https://issues.apache.org/jira/browse/GOBBLIN-2175?focusedWorklogId=946733&page=com.atlassian.jira.plugin.system.issuetabpanels:worklog-tabpanel#worklog-946733 ]
ASF GitHub Bot logged work on GOBBLIN-2175: ------------------------------------------- Author: ASF GitHub Bot Created on: 04/Dec/24 17:09 Start Date: 04/Dec/24 17:09 Worklog Time Spent: 10m Work Description: pratapaditya04 commented on code in PR #4078: URL: https://github.com/apache/gobblin/pull/4078#discussion_r1869962823 ########## gobblin-temporal/src/main/java/org/apache/gobblin/temporal/ddm/workflow/impl/ProcessWorkUnitsWorkflowImpl.java: ########## @@ -72,9 +72,20 @@ private CommitStats performWork(WUProcessingSpec workSpec) { searchAttributes = TemporalWorkFlowUtils.generateGaasSearchAttributes(jobState.getProperties()); NestingExecWorkflow<WorkUnitClaimCheck> processingWorkflow = createProcessingWorkflow(workSpec, searchAttributes); - int workunitsProcessed = - processingWorkflow.performWorkload(WorkflowAddr.ROOT, workload, 0, workSpec.getTuning().getMaxBranchesPerTree(), - workSpec.getTuning().getMaxSubTreesPerTree(), Optional.empty()); + + int workunitsProcessed = 0; + try { + workunitsProcessed = processingWorkflow.performWorkload(WorkflowAddr.ROOT, workload, 0, + workSpec.getTuning().getMaxBranchesPerTree(), workSpec.getTuning().getMaxSubTreesPerTree(), Optional.empty()); + } catch (Exception e) { + log.error("Exception occurred in performing workload,proceeding with commit step", e); + return proceedWithCommitStepAndReturnCommitStats(workSpec, searchAttributes, workunitsProcessed); Review Comment: addressed , sending failure event along with proceeding with commit step Issue Time Tracking ------------------- Worklog Id: (was: 946733) Time Spent: 0.5h (was: 20m) > Fix partial commit in temporal flow > ----------------------------------- > > Key: GOBBLIN-2175 > URL: https://issues.apache.org/jira/browse/GOBBLIN-2175 > Project: Apache Gobblin > Issue Type: Bug > Reporter: Aditya Pratap Singh > Priority: Major > Time Spent: 0.5h > Remaining Estimate: 0h > > Fix partial commit in temporal flow -- This message was sent by Atlassian Jira (v8.20.10#820010)